Review - Promise Me Once by Paige Weaver



Title: Promise Me Once
Series: Promise Me #3
Author: Paige Weaver
Release Date: April 19, 2015




Once with him was never enough.

I am the girl you dislike. The girl you snub at parties. I am the one who flirts with men and knows no boundaries. I am the one you whisper about. The one who has no rules. I am the one who takes and uses without any regret or excuses.

On the outside I am perfect. I have money, looks, and a personality that makes people stand up and take notice, but on the inside I am broken and hurting.

Then I met Cash Marshall.

He wasn’t what I needed, but I wanted him anyway. It was Cash’s carved, muscular body I thought about. It was his cool, confident touch I craved. I swore he would only be a one-night stand, another distraction to take away the pain.

But then our world changed.

Our story is not about love. Love is pretty and sweet and full of niceties. Those no longer exist. Our story is about finding each other again in a world gone crazy. It’s about surviving the impossible when war ravaged our land. It’s about saving each other from the darkness and finding out just how strong we could be.

And maybe, just maybe, along the way, we’ll find love…

Once and for all.

I need some Cash -- and that has nothing to do with money! Cash Marshall, "looked like a recovering addict's worst nightmare." Another swoony cowboy in Dallas to drool over, ladies. He’s a hard working, hay throwin' Texan who falls hard for someone he never expected to.

Cat is a "numb and wild" child. Town royalty. Spoiled, gorgeous, famous one-night-stand queen! Until Cash. Their chemistry is apparent from the very start.

I loved, loved, loved the first two books in this Promise Meseries. This most recent one can be read as a standalone, and is set within the time period of the first book. As before, this edition has steamy, dreamy love scenes with a huge twist of events!!

"...too surreal to believe. Too terrible to understand."

And yet, it all could happen. Which makes this a great read. With believable characters and events, there is something intoxicating about Ms. Weaver's writing. I read a lot of books, but very few get my heart racing and make me hold my breath. Paige has NEVER disappointed me with that. The men she brings alive on the pages are real, breathtaking, manly men. Perfect; flaws and all.

This is NOT your typical cowboy romance. At all. So glad to finally read Cash's story and cannot WAIT for more! I loved every page. 5 "Take me, cowboy" stars!

Paige Weaver’s first passion has always been reading. Many hours of her childhood were spent getting lost between the pages of a book, disappearing into other worlds. That turned into a love for writing at a young age. Her first book, Promise Me Darkness, became a New York Times and USA Today bestseller quickly after being released.

Paige lives in Texas with her husband and two children. When she's not writing or reading, you can find her chasing her kids around and living her very own happily ever-after.
